Demystifying the Writ of Garnishment
Encountering a writ of garnishment can be a challenging ordeal. It’s pivotal for involved parties to grasp the nuances of this legal measure to safeguard their financial interests effectively. This directive permits creditors to seize a debtor’s assets, comprising wages and bank balances, to fulfill an outstanding debt.
Essentials of Issuing a Writ
The journey to a writ of garnishment inception involves a creditor securing a court verdict prior to petitioning for such an order. Succinct review by a judicial authority ensures the process adheres strictly to the merit of the claim.
Garnishment Varieties
Distinct variations of garnishments persist; wage garnishment directly intercepts a debtor’s earnings, whereas bank garnishment aims at the individual’s banking reserves.
Interpreting Relevant Garnishment Statutes
The labyrinth of garnishment statutes is guided by both state-specific and federal frameworks. Notably, federal statutes cap the quota of disposable income subject to garnishment.

Strategic Responses to Garnishment Notices
Upon receipt of a garnishment alert, immediate and calculated actions are crucial. One could petition against the writ or opt for consensual payment schemes with the creditor.
Exclusions and Safeguards in Garnishment
Some income types, like social security or veteran’s pensions, are commonly insulated from garnishment. The Consumer Credit Protection Act also shields employees from job loss due to single-debt wage garnishments.

Multi-Garnishment Dynamics
In scenarios featuring concurrent garnishments, procedural precedents govern the allocation and prioritization, often dictated by the nature of the debt and the sequential order of garnishment filings.
